Also known as democratic leadership, participative leadership allows everyone on the team to get involved and work together to make important decisions. According to the Great Man Theory (which should perhaps be called the Great Person Theory), leaders are born with just the right traits and abilities for leading – charisma, intellect, confidence, communication skills, and social skills.
